Completed
Adaptive Phone Orientation Section
Some users with older android devices that have faulty accelerometer sensors or do not have them at all reported facing issues with the phone placement check. We are planning to replace the phone placement screen with a video after running some background checks. This development might involve clear separation of steps (1st audio check and then phone placement) Addition: Silently play audio in start workout button to record user permission before displaying audio check page with accelerometer

Vladimir Shetnikov 3 months ago
Completed
Adaptive Phone Orientation Section
Some users with older android devices that have faulty accelerometer sensors or do not have them at all reported facing issues with the phone placement check. We are planning to replace the phone placement screen with a video after running some background checks. This development might involve clear separation of steps (1st audio check and then phone placement) Addition: Silently play audio in start workout button to record user permission before displaying audio check page with accelerometer

Vladimir Shetnikov 3 months ago
Completed
Migration to new infrastructure
We are migrating our content library to a new infrastructure and functionalities of our admin panel as well. Your and your users experience is our top priority so we are making sure we do it with with most care and fallback capabilities to ensure a smooth transition. Once the transition is complete, you will see up to 80% improvements in loading times for some of our features.

Vladimir Shetnikov 3 months ago
Completed
Migration to new infrastructure
We are migrating our content library to a new infrastructure and functionalities of our admin panel as well. Your and your users experience is our top priority so we are making sure we do it with with most care and fallback capabilities to ensure a smooth transition. Once the transition is complete, you will see up to 80% improvements in loading times for some of our features.

Vladimir Shetnikov 3 months ago
In Progress
Update Feedback Modal Design
This feature is optional but is enabled by default. We will update the interface slightly to make sure the feedback we receive is categorized correctly.

Vladimir Shetnikov 3 months ago
In Progress
Update Feedback Modal Design
This feature is optional but is enabled by default. We will update the interface slightly to make sure the feedback we receive is categorized correctly.

Vladimir Shetnikov 3 months ago
Completed
(Optional - will be enabled by default iOS only) Connecting to TV
We want to help users understand how to cast/mirror their phone screen to a TV in order to improve their experience — because using the app on a big screen will be much more convenient. You will be able to control whether or not to allow this instruction popup, but it will be enabled by default on iOS.

Vladimir Shetnikov 3 months ago
Completed
(Optional - will be enabled by default iOS only) Connecting to TV
We want to help users understand how to cast/mirror their phone screen to a TV in order to improve their experience — because using the app on a big screen will be much more convenient. You will be able to control whether or not to allow this instruction popup, but it will be enabled by default on iOS.

Vladimir Shetnikov 3 months ago
Completed
Skeleton visual improvements & Visual Feedbacks
Improve the skeleton's visual appearance so that it is clearly visible from a distance, and also enhance its visuals during “Session Replay”. We plan not only to report feedback in real time but also to visually display it so that it’s clearer for users. Based on this, the color of the skeleton itself will also change for the user.

Vladimir Shetnikov 3 months ago
Completed
Skeleton visual improvements & Visual Feedbacks
Improve the skeleton's visual appearance so that it is clearly visible from a distance, and also enhance its visuals during “Session Replay”. We plan not only to report feedback in real time but also to visually display it so that it’s clearer for users. Based on this, the color of the skeleton itself will also change for the user.

Vladimir Shetnikov 3 months ago
Completed
Initial Position Check Improvements (Silhouette)
We have completely redesigned and updated the visual guidance for entering the frame. We’ll make it much clearer and add visual feedback.

Vladimir Shetnikov 3 months ago
Completed
Initial Position Check Improvements (Silhouette)
We have completely redesigned and updated the visual guidance for entering the frame. We’ll make it much clearer and add visual feedback.

Vladimir Shetnikov 3 months ago
Completed
Incorrect Camera Preview During Skeleton Calibration
During the skeleton matching calibration step, the camera preview is shifted up, cropping the user's video feed from the chest up. Despite the incorrect positioning, the voice feedback confirms the position is okay and the exercise starts. The camera preview corrects itself and displays normally after the exercise begins. Device: Samsung Galaxy M11

Ruslan Team 6 months ago
Completed
Incorrect Camera Preview During Skeleton Calibration
During the skeleton matching calibration step, the camera preview is shifted up, cropping the user's video feed from the chest up. Despite the incorrect positioning, the voice feedback confirms the position is okay and the exercise starts. The camera preview corrects itself and displays normally after the exercise begins. Device: Samsung Galaxy M11

Ruslan Team 6 months ago
Rejected
Missing Exercise Cover Photo
The cover photo for an exercise is not displayed, showing a blank white space instead. The image was uploaded in WEBP format via the admin panel and was taken from another exercise that already exists in the system. Device: Samsung Galaxy M11

Ruslan Team 6 months ago
Rejected
Missing Exercise Cover Photo
The cover photo for an exercise is not displayed, showing a blank white space instead. The image was uploaded in WEBP format via the admin panel and was taken from another exercise that already exists in the system. Device: Samsung Galaxy M11

Ruslan Team 6 months ago
Completed
Unresponsive Phone Positioning Screen
The screen before the exercise begins (for phone positioning) is completely unresponsive. The 'Skip' button is too small and not easily noticeable, especially when the phone is placed on the floor and the user is at a distance. Device: Samsung Galaxy M11

Ruslan Team 6 months ago
Completed
Unresponsive Phone Positioning Screen
The screen before the exercise begins (for phone positioning) is completely unresponsive. The 'Skip' button is too small and not easily noticeable, especially when the phone is placed on the floor and the user is at a distance. Device: Samsung Galaxy M11

Ruslan Team 6 months ago
Completed
Translation from English to Arabic
Replace all places where English is not translated into Arabic, according to the PDF file

Ruslan Team 6 months ago
Completed
Translation from English to Arabic
Replace all places where English is not translated into Arabic, according to the PDF file

Ruslan Team 6 months ago
Completed
Notations for exercises with motion detection
Add notations to know if the exercise is with enabled motion detection or not

Ruslan Team 6 months ago
Completed
Notations for exercises with motion detection
Add notations to know if the exercise is with enabled motion detection or not

Ruslan Team 6 months ago
Filter for exercises with motion detection
Improve the APIs and the Admin dashboard to have filter for exercises with motion detection

Ruslan Team 6 months ago
Filter for exercises with motion detection
Improve the APIs and the Admin dashboard to have filter for exercises with motion detection

Ruslan Team 6 months ago
Completed
Hiding the evaluation screen
Prepare the code snippet how to hide the evaluation screen after the exercise done without motion detection

Ruslan Team 6 months ago
Completed
Hiding the evaluation screen
Prepare the code snippet how to hide the evaluation screen after the exercise done without motion detection

Ruslan Team 6 months ago
Completed
Remove loading window
Loading window consist of two things White screen and the black screen loader (green) We do not want that white screen

Ruslan Team 6 months ago
Completed
Remove loading window
Loading window consist of two things White screen and the black screen loader (green) We do not want that white screen

Ruslan Team 6 months ago
Completed
Sort by exercises done
in the admin panel it is important to make sort by exercises done so you can see who did the most

Ruslan Team 6 months ago
Completed
Sort by exercises done
in the admin panel it is important to make sort by exercises done so you can see who did the most

Ruslan Team 6 months ago
Completed
Swapping screens
It is necessary to make it possible for the user to choose which screen will be the main one: with the trainer's video, or the video from the camera with the user.

Ruslan Team 6 months ago
Completed
Swapping screens
It is necessary to make it possible for the user to choose which screen will be the main one: with the trainer's video, or the video from the camera with the user.

Ruslan Team 6 months ago
Completed
Request for new events (workout started and workout exit)
We are using KinesteXAIFramework.createWorkoutView widget to open up kinestex workout within our flutter app. We would like raise the following concerns 1. We do not get a web view message named WorkoutStarted at all, so instead we rely on the custom message of type 'person_in_frame' to undertstand that the workout has indeed started. 2. We do not want to show the Kinestex default workout summary screen and show our upload screen, this was raised by us earlier, to which we were advised to show an overlay on top of your widget screen as soon as we get the workoutOverview message> We have imlemented the same but then still we always see your summary screen for a second before our overlay is shown on the screen. Do you have a workaround to fix this? Attaching herewith the code indicating how things are implemented within our app

Vladimir Shetnikov 8 months ago
Completed
Request for new events (workout started and workout exit)
We are using KinesteXAIFramework.createWorkoutView widget to open up kinestex workout within our flutter app. We would like raise the following concerns 1. We do not get a web view message named WorkoutStarted at all, so instead we rely on the custom message of type 'person_in_frame' to undertstand that the workout has indeed started. 2. We do not want to show the Kinestex default workout summary screen and show our upload screen, this was raised by us earlier, to which we were advised to show an overlay on top of your widget screen as soon as we get the workoutOverview message> We have imlemented the same but then still we always see your summary screen for a second before our overlay is shown on the screen. Do you have a workaround to fix this? Attaching herewith the code indicating how things are implemented within our app

Vladimir Shetnikov 8 months ago